Uber announced earlier that it would officially launch aUber WorksTemporary employee matching services.
As early as last year, Uber had conducted early tests in Los Angeles and also launched a service operation experience in the Chicago area for several months. It is now officially launched and has become one of Uber's new business projects.
Uber Works' service is somewhat similar to the current Uber EATS food delivery matching service, except that it replaces food delivery with temporary employees, allowing people with temporary work needs to find suitable personnel through this service, and also allowing people who can provide work services to quickly find job opportunities through this service.
This service is expected to be launched in the Chicago area of the United States first, allowing employers with temporary employee resource needs to send job details including salary, work location, and required skills through this service. Uber will also conduct background checks and relevant skills assessments on temporary workers participating in this service, allowing employers to feel at ease seeking temporary workers through the Uber Works service.
Compared to the traditional method of seeking temporary employees through advertising, Uber believes that matching through its own platform will enable employers to hire temporary workers more efficiently and safely. It will also allow people who earn a living through temporary work to find suitable jobs more quickly, thereby reducing the time and cost required to find suitable jobs.
However, this service may also face some legal issues. For example, the temporary employees mentioned in this service are not formal employees. This part will obviously conflict with the recent bill passed in California requiring independent contractors to treat cooperative workers as formal employees. For example, Uber or Lyft's cooperative service drivers must be able to receive the same treatment as formal employees. Therefore, the Uber Works service may be adjusted in the future in response to current laws.

The Uber Works service also offers the option to choose the actual size of staff and type of service required. The service will also cooperate with temporary human resources contractors, allowing the Uber service platform to become a temporary employee or professional human resources matching platform.
